Ag Safety Day

Tuesday May 2nd, the MMCRU FFA and agriculture classes hosted an ag safety day for both Marcus and Remsen Elementary classes. FFA Committee members Sophie Hohbach, Emma Vasher & Mason Peters organized seven different stations to have the kids go through at the Marcus Fairgrounds. There were soil cup snacks, the Hohbach’s gravity wagon basketball game as the game, the Industrial Tech’s tractor to learn about parts and safety, a UTV and a mower, the Marcus and Remsen fire departments to talk to the kids about grain bin safety, Tim Smith brought a done to teach the kids what they are doing around here, and FFA members brought in a calf and two lambs to learn about the animals. In total, 350 kids passed through stations and were given safety instructions to be more aware as they visit a farm or surrounding area. With Marcus in the morning and Remsen in the afternoon, the day was filled with lots of learning and fun! “Thank you so much for such a wonderfully organized and planned Ag Safety Day! The high school kids really did an amazing job, and it was so worthwhile!” said Ann Barkel Marcus 2nd grade teacher.
